Configuring SNMP
Chapter 19: Maintenance 597
Configuring SNMP
The UTM-1 appliance users can monitor the UTM-1 appliance, using tools that support
SNMP (Simple Network Management Protocol). You can enable users to do so via the
Internet, by configuring remote SNMP access.
The UTM-1 appliance supports the following SNMP MIBs:
SNMPv2-MIB
RFC1213-MIB
IF-MIB
IP-MIB
All SNMP access is read-only.
Note: Configuring SNMP is equivalent to creating a simple Allow rule, where the
destination is This Gateway. To create more complex rules for SNMP, such as
allowing SNMP connections from multiple IP address ranges, define Allow rules for
the relevant port (by default, TCP port 161), with the destination This Gateway. For
information, see Using Rules on page
334.
